Output ef6c0eecbba89fdadb64bc58d195b3b89a49364cb0a4adeda00bb53386e47b95:0

value
4462695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c873fd1871aa6033b1c363ca7da132e4be9890 OP_EQUAL
address
3NTRSp8nECghTyxQTrrU8ajuLZzwVjm9JD
transaction
ef6c0eecbba89fdadb64bc58d195b3b89a49364cb0a4adeda00bb53386e47b95
spent
false

3 Sat Ranges